White MacBook last MacBook standing

Written By admin On June 8th, 2009

Apple wasn’t totally clear about this earlier, but it turns out all the unibody MacBook models are now MacBook Pros — the only remaining “MacBook” is the white plastic number. Apple quietly updates $999 MacBook, again — goes back to school with free iPod touch

Written By admin On May 27th, 2009

Shh, don’t tell the press but Apple just bumped the specs on its entry-level white MacBook again. The bump measures in at just 0.13GHz on the processor, 133MHz more oomph from the DDR2 SDRAM, and an extra 40GB of disk space. Still more is more better especially when it’s free $999.
